More news after the break. The money is starting to add up. Bart s legal tab to fight state regulatory fines related to the the money is starting to add up. B. A. R. T. s legal tab to fight state regulatory fines related to the deaths of two workers will likely top half a million dollars. That sum comes as b. A. R. T. Is making cuts to close a 30 million budget gap. Investigative reporter jackson van derbeken has the exclusive details now on b. A. R. T. s legal bill that could end up being higher than the total amount of fines its facing. Reporter state regulators blame b. A. R. T. s poor and inadequate Safety Culture for the deaths of two track workers hit by a b. A. R. T. Train here four years ago. They point to the incab Surveillance Video we showed you last week as proof that the driver in training who was operating his first train on open tracks was not able to sound the horn after he spotted the workers up ahead. And the trainer wasnt there to help. Hed left the trainee alone at the controls as he sat and used his cell phone in the passenger area instead. Even grumbling at one point about having to help him. How many more times are you going to make me get up . Reporter the agency insists the lapses were isolated and not proof of more widespread safety problems. B. A. R. T. s fighting the California Public Utilities Commission 600,000 fine. B. A. R. T. Told us the violations alleged by the cpuc concern an individual employees violation of a b. A. R. T. Rural, not a gap in b. A. R. T. Safety rules or general failure by b. A. R. T. To enforce those rules. B. A. R. T. Told us today the agency has spent 450,000 as of last month with more bills on the way. Its now authorized to spend a total of nearly 600,000 for the fight. B. A. R. T. Is even challenging the fining authority of the state Agency Charged with ensuring public safety. The cpuc. B. A. R. T. Contends the commission lacks the power to levy fines for b. A. R. T. s breaking of its own rules. 500,000 would go a long ways for b. A. R. T. Reporter if b. A. R. T. Prevails, it could weaken state rail safety enforcement says state senator jerry hill. It shouldnt be spent on attorneys trying to fight the puc and at the same time that theyre fighting them theyre trying to undermine the pucs Safety Ability and their responsibility as a safety body. They should get over it, move forward, and forget defending themselves because you captant defend yourself when youre wrong. Reporter the judge in the regulatory case could rule any day now whether b. A. R. T. Should be fined. Jackson v jaxon van derbeken, nbc bay area news. B. A. R. T. Did send a statement defending the legal bills. The Statement Reads in part, the expenditures are reasonable and fiscally responsible in light of the cpucs unsubstantiated claims and allegations. On september 9, 2010, pg e learned a tragic lesson we can never forget. This gas pipeline ruptured in san bruno. The explosion and fire killed eight people. Pg e was convicted of six felony charges including five violations of the u. S. Pipeline safety act and obstructing an ntsb investigation. Pg e was fined, placed under an outside monitor, given five years of probation, and required to perform 10,000 hours of community service. We are deeply sorry. We failed our customers in san bruno. More than 40,000 people ran in the London Marathon. Two are former soldiers who formed a pretty unusual and incredible bond. As nbcs tammy lightener reports, running in not just win but two marathons this week. It is the latest way of overcoming challenges. Reporter for most people running one marathon is an accomplishment. What about two . On two continents less than a week apart . Thats exactly what carl an injured british soldier and ivan castro, a blind american vet have done. Tethered together by a shoe string, crossing the finish line at the boston marathon. In six days and one long airplane flight later completing the London Marathon today. Who came up with this crazy idea . I think this crazy idea was made up by prince harry. Reporter thats right. Prince harry and ivan castro have known each other since 2013 when the prince trekked to the south pole with a group of injured military vets. I not only consider him a friend, i consider him a brother. He rule truly cares about different issues around the world. Reporter including one started by the young royals. Heads together, helped soldiers and others struggling with mental health. I was in basra iraq. Reporter he was 19 when a gas bomb was thrown at his tank. I started using running as a therapy because coming from such a responsible job role to being in a bed and no independence you needed something to fill the void. And running did that for me. Reporter hes run marathons and ultra marathons around the world, from norway to brazil, the sahara to ant arctic, boston was number 150. But this time is different. This race is not just for himself, but for ivan as well who lost his eyesight after a mortar attack while serving in iraq. A duo, each step in unison, one step closer to victory. Two survivors stronger together than apart. Not an easy race for a blind guy. We did it together. Reporter tammy lightener, nbc news, london. Really cool. They win. They do, thats for sure.
